Anatolian Beyliks. Anonymous. Ca. 1350. AR "gigliato" (30 mm, 3.70 g, 8 h). Imitating a gigliato of Robert d'Anjou of Naples in Italy. King enthroned facing / Cross fleury. Cf. Schlumberger pl. XVIII, 18. Choice VF, nicely toned and exceptionally nice for this extremely rare issue.
According to Schlumberger, this imitation was struck under either the Beylik of Aydin or Menteshe. See Album 15, 359, for the only other example we could find (crude and poorly centered; realized $425 + BP).
